No Lowkey MV Review: Jessi and CAMO Ignite the Screen with Their Fiery Performance

The long-awaited No Lowkey MV has finally arrived on April 9, 2024, marking a thrilling collaboration between K-pop sensation Jessi, Yungin, and CAMO. After a hiatus of five months following her last release, Gum, in October 2023, Jessi returns with her trademark boldness and unapologetic style. Renowned for defying stereotypes and breaking boundaries in the K-pop scene, Jessi continues to captivate audiences with her fearless authenticity. With NO LOWKEY, she reaffirms her status as a trailblazer, challenging societal norms and empowering women through her dynamic artistry. With powerful vocals and striking visuals, Jessi once again proves her ability to inspire and connect with fans on a deeply resonant level.

No Lowkey MV Review

Jessi consistently delivers vibrant, playful rap tracks, regardless of her label affiliation. “No Lowkey” epitomizes the essence of Jessi: lively, slightly goofy, and irresistibly catchy with its concept-driven approach. While not always a guaranteed hit, adjusting your expectations ensures a rollicking good time. The song itself, while lacking a standout hook, exudes undeniable fun. Particularly noteworthy is the production, eschewing mainstream trends for a throwback groove infused with an infectious rhythm and boundless energy.

The dynamic duo of Jessi and CAMO elevates the song to new heights, injecting their unique vibe and owning every moment. Their infectious energy compensates for the song’s repetitive structure, making it an enjoyable listen. Jessi, in particular, epitomizes the unapologetically bold, cartoonish sound, serving as its perfect ambassador. Her magnetic personality propels the track forward, exuding amiability and a willingness to embrace humour. Even though “No Lowkey” may not rank among her most impactful works, Jessi’s unwavering commitment remains palpable, infusing the song with an irresistible charm that leaves listeners captivated.

In essence, No Lowkey may not boast the strongest hook, but it more than makes up for it with its sheer exuberance and infectious energy. Jessi’s undeniable charisma, coupled with CAMO’s contributions, ensures a memorable musical experience. While the song may not reach the heights of Jessi’s best material, its playful nature and infectious rhythm make it a worthwhile addition to her repertoire. Ultimately, No Lowkey music video stands as a testament to Jessi’s ability to captivate audiences with her larger-than-life persona and unapologetically bold sound.

Moreover, Jessi’s No Lowkey serves as the perfect visual accompaniment to the track’s lively atmosphere. Bursting with vibrant colours, dynamic choreography, and playful imagery, the video encapsulates the essence of Jessi’s persona. Her commanding presence on screen, coupled with the seamless integration of comedic elements, ensures an engaging viewing experience from start to finish. Each frame is a testament to the song’s infectious energy, further solidifying Jessi’s status as a captivating performer in the world of K-pop. Overall, the music video enhances the song’s appeal, offering fans a visually stimulating journey into Jessi’s colourful world.
